The field of organic electronics is a rapidly evolving domain, driving innovation in areas like flexible displays, organic photovoltaics (OPVs), and organic field-effect transistors (OFETs). At the heart of these technologies are specialized organic materials, often synthesized from carefully designed chemical intermediates. Among these, carbazole derivatives have garnered significant attention for their excellent charge transport properties and tunable electronic characteristics. Carbazole derivatives, such as 10-Bromo-7H-benzo[c]carbazole (CAS: 1698-16-4), serve as fundamental building blocks in the creation of advanced organic semiconductors. The carbazole moiety itself is known for its electron-rich nature and good hole-transporting capabilities, making it an ideal component for various layers within electronic devices, including hole-transporting layers (HTLs) and host materials in OLEDs. The bromine substituent in 10-Bromo-7H-benzo[c]carbazole provides a reactive site for further synthetic modifications, allowing for the creation of even more sophisticated functional materials with optimized performance.
